Leader made some really good points (pardon the pun!) this week, which I thought were quite relevant considering some of the posts.

She said that guilt is a destructive emotion, and there shouldn't be ANY guilt for using up our weekly 49, as that's what they're there for. She also added that we are all adults, and that as such we should be allowed to put fuel into our bodies without feeling bad about it - and that the 49 form part of the fuel, as the dailies + weeklies = CALORIE DEFICIT!

So let's all eat our 49, spend it on curry and fish 'n' chips an be happy about it! Grin
